Super cute little wine bar. Who would have ever thought something like this would be in the middle of little old Middletown. They have plenty of wine to choose from. When we walked in, Tiff D. and I were greeted by the co-owner, Monica. She was super friendly and nice. She explained to us a few wine selections and their origin. She offered us a flight of wine and a charcuterie board. We enjoyed the delicious board filled with different meats, cheeses, jams, nuts and chocolate. The wines we had in our flight were Presecco, Rosè, Cab Sauv, and a Moscato. The wines were all tasty yet different. We really enjoyed and appreciated each for the flavor it lent. This is also a cute date night spot for happy hour or a night out with the girls. I plan to bring my husband here. Overall, I really enjoyed my experience here at West Central.

This was originally a "speakeasy" but has since gotten HUGE signage directing you to it, so really…read moredoesn't qualify anymore. You can either walk through the gun center or enter at the rear / side of the building. Either way it is a bit of a walk so could be a concern for anyone with mobility issues. I was surprised that there were not any disabled parking spots close to the side entrance. It's a large lounge, upscale and beautifully decorated though does not have an intimate feel. Majority of seating is tables vs. bar. The cocktail menu is unique and fun, with the different drinks named after famous and infamous gunslingers. I had a Baby Face Nelson which was attractive and delicious. At first I though it was a little weak but towards the end it hit with a bang (see what I did there). I also took advantage of the ladies night menu and got a $5 cucumber mint G&T. The cocktail pricing is what you'd expect, ranging from $12 to $16. The wine list is not extensive and I would not describe this as a wine bar. But, I would come here seeking a fancy cocktail anyway. No food served, but door dash menus are available and there is also a limited menu for direct delivery from the Indian restaurant across the road. The outdoor patio looks nice. We were there on the earlier side, around 5 PM on a weekday. Service was pretty attentive with only one waitress handling the tables. I think if they found a way to serve some simple appetizers and put in a railing along the walkway from the parking lot to the door (thinking of my husband here) I'd give it five stars. They have a weird rule in that they insist on scanning your ID, regardless of age, up until 7 PM any day - this is so that no one who orders a drink can go next door and shoot (where they also scan IDs). The shooting range closes at 7 PM. So shoot first, drink later.
